Guaiian is a Taukan language spoken primarily in Guai where it is the de facto official language. Guaiian is also called Bahma Guai (Language of Guai) or Bahmaia (Our language).

Vowels

Guaiian vowels

Guaiian has 11 different vowels. These can be short or long, long vowels being marked with a macron.

Retracted vowels: à/ʌ/, è /ə/ and ì /y/ cannot be lengthened. Moreover, in multisyllabic words, syllables composed by these vowels are unstressed. Some dialects consider these three vowels as ultra-short vowels, setting them apart from regular short and long vowels

On the contrary, syllables with long vowels are always stressed.

Guaiian has been written using an extended Romantian alphabet since the mid/late 17th Century.

Diacritics

Guaiian uses four kinds of diacritics: acute accent (´), grave accent (`), macron(¯), diaeresis (¨).

  • Acute accent marks stress if it does not follow the most common pattern.
  • Grave accent retracts the pronunciation of the vowel. In multisyllabic words, syllables composed by these vowels are unstressed.
  • Macron indicates a long vowel.
  • Diaeresis TBC

Grammar

Guaiian is a mostly analytic language with little inflection and a fixed SVO word order.

Nouns

Guaiian is a genderless language, words - uegia (/'wegja/)- are neutral and do not inflect for plural. Numbers are expressed by articles or cardinal numbers expressing plural. If one needs to specify the gender of a person, one may use "co-" /ʃɔ/ or "ci-" /ʃi/ prefixes such as in copadia (/ʃɔ'padja/ male teacher) or cipadia (/ʃi'padja/ female teacher).

article

The article - mio-uengia (/mjo 'wegja/ word-shower) - conveys the following notions: definiteness, indefiniteness and number:

Feature Singular Plural Dual
Indefiniteness è ā ii
Definiteness tè or t' tii

Originally, is the apocope of an archaic demonstrative article tèdh (/təð/). Singular definite article becomes t' before a vowel. Dual, once more used, is now restricted to periods of time, body parts and objects coming in pair.


Pronouns

Personal pronouns

Guaiian makes use of personal pronouns when the pronoun is subject to a verb (to some extent), otherwise, inflected prepositions are usually used instead.

Prepositions

As the object of a preposition, a pronoun is fused with the preposition; one speaks here of "inflected" prepositions, or, as they are more commonly termed, prepositional pronouns.

Vocabulary

Most of Guaiian words are of Taukan origin and quite few may be related to Pre-Taukan roots, except toponyms. Guaiian vocabulary has been enriched over the centuries with Tenibri, Ingerish and Castellanese loanwords. Since the 1950s, Paxlinga has played a more prominent supplier of loanwords due to Paxtaren cultural influence in Guai.

Numerals

Guaiian numbers are based on a decimal system. They are not capitalised and different units are hyphened. When written with digits, the coma is used as decimal mark and Guaiians favour digit grouping.

Ordinal numbers

Except dja (Guaiian for first), all ordinal numbers follow this basic rule:

1- Cardinal numbers ending with a consonant form their ordinal correspondent by adding a -e at their end.

2- Cardinal numbers ending with a vowel form their ordinal correspondent by adding a -le at their end.
